Buying Guide: Navy Blue Beach Cruiser Purchases

  • Where will you ride most often? Choose wheel size and gearing that match terrain—26″ wheels with 7 speeds suit mixed surfaces, while single-speed models excel on flat paths.
  • How important is comfort? Look for padded saddles, adjustable handlebars, and upright riding positions to minimize back and shoulder strain.
  • What is your maintenance tolerance? Single-speed bikes are simpler but less versatile on hills; multi-gear bikes require routine gear checks.
  • Frame and weight: steel frames offer durability but can be heavier; lighter options exist but may compromise some durability.
  • Aesthetic and fit: navy or blue tones should match your wardrobe and preferred bike style; ensure the model’s size fits your height for optimal posture.

Frequently Asked Questions

  • What makes navy blue cruiser bikes popular? Classic styling, comfortable riding positions, and versatile use from boardwalk to neighborhood streets.
  • Is a single-speed cruiser suitable for hilly areas? Generally not ideal; multi-speed cruisers perform better on varied terrain.
  • What should I consider when choosing wheel size? 26″ wheels are common for adults and offer good stability; 24″ wheels suit shorter riders.
  • Are cruiser bikes easy to maintain? Yes, especially single-speed models; derailleur-equipped cruisers need periodic gear adjustments.
  • Do cruiser bikes require special brakes? Many use rear coaster brakes or V-brakes; ensure braking meets your stopping needs.
  • Can I use a cruiser for commuting? Yes, many models support casual commuting with upright comfort and stable handling.
